[geary] Fix error when adding third account. Bug 779048.



commit d4a95fa2876d7f196b16b2724fd851a4ed272920
Author: Michael James Gratton <mike vee net>
Date:   Thu Feb 23 11:27:39 2017 +1100

    Fix error when adding third account. Bug 779048.
    
    Patch courtesy of RafaƂ Masternak <rafdev muub net>

 src/engine/api/geary-engine.vala |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/src/engine/api/geary-engine.vala b/src/engine/api/geary-engine.vala
index faaf818..bd36ba2 100644
--- a/src/engine/api/geary-engine.vala
+++ b/src/engine/api/geary-engine.vala
@@ -279,7 +279,7 @@ public class Geary.Engine : BaseObject {
         string? last_account = this.accounts.keys.fold<string?>((next, last) => {
                 string? result = last;
                 if (next.has_prefix(ID_PREFIX)) {
-                    result = (last == null || strcmp(last, next) > 0) ? next : last;
+                    result = (last == null || strcmp(last, next) < 0) ? next : last;
                 }
                 return result;
             },


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]